How to make motion blur photography | Adobe

    https://www.adobe.com/creativecloud/photography/discover/motion-blur-photography.html
    Motion blur is all about shutter speed and how it interacts with light. You create the blur with a slow shutter speed. The slower your shutter speed (sometimes called a long shutter speed), the more light gets to your camera sensor. Because your shutter is open longer, more visual information is captured, which can include the blur of motion.

Introduce Motion Blur to Your Photography Portfolio (10 Beginner …

    https://motionarray.com/learn/photography/motion-blur-photography/
    You can create motion blur after the event in Photoshop, by selecting the subject or area you want to blur with the Pen tool, using the Motion Blur filter (Filter > Blur > Motion Blur), and choosing how much blur you want to appear in your shot by adjusting the Angle and Distance according to the direction you want it to move in.

How To Create Photographic Illusion With Motion Blur …

    https://www.photodoto.com/motion-blur-photography-tips/
    The best motion blur photography tip to create a blur is by slowing down the shutter speed. To begin, keep the shutter speed at 1/200th of a second and from there slow it down depending on the speed of the subject. You will get to know the optimum shutter speed by experimenting as the speed of the subject also matters.
